When comparing heat pump vs solar hot water, it often comes down to roof space, orientation, and whether you already have solar PV. A solar hot water vs electric hot water decision is similar: if you have plenty of sun and roof area, a solar hot water system can be very cost effective; if shade or roof layout is tricky, a compact heat pump hot water system may be the better fit. Either way, modern systems are far more efficient than old electric hot water vs gas hot water units.
Hot water system price will vary with tank size, brand and whether you need a solar hot water tank replacement, extra plumbing, or switchboard upgrades. Heat pump hot water price is usually higher upfront than a basic electric hot water installation, but much lower to run. Solar hot water price depends on collector type and roof work, but again, the long‑term savings can be substantial.
In Cynthia QLD, homeowners can tap into a mix of Australian Government and state incentives to bring down the cost of going efficient. Federal Small‑scale Technology Certificates (STCs) apply to eligible solar hot water and heat pump systems, effectively acting as an upfront discount at the point of sale. On top of that, Queensland hot water rebate programs for efficient systems – especially heat pumps – can further reduce the heat pump hot water price or solar hot water price. These hot water rebate QLD schemes can cut the system cost by a sizeable percentage and shorten payback to just a few years, especially if you also run the system on solar.
For some Cynthia homes, an electric hot water system rebate may be available when upgrading from an old, inefficient unit to a more efficient hot water QLD‑approved model. Using timers or smart controls to run a heat pump when your solar is producing, or using solar diversion to heat water during the day, can boost savings even more.
